If so, put on your best shoulder-padded, sequined dress and head to the Colony Theatre this weekend for The Golden Gays, a musical drag spoof of those OG cougars, The Golden Girls. The Los Angeles-spawned play is having its three-show East Coast debut in the frisky foursome’s TV hometown, Miami. It centers on four male superfans urged by their psychologist to indulge their rhinestone-studded and liver-spotted fantasies by moving in together and dressing like Rose, Blanche, Dorothy, and Sophia.
